The brochure will have floor plan of the stacks but no dimensions, it just show u the layout! And also, every stack will have slightly different measurements here and there. So the one they gave out during ur selection is the most accurate cause those are specific floor plans (exact dimensions included) for each stack each floor.

For those wanting the very top floor, do consider the heat. I am currently living in top floor unit ( only living room has executive on top ) the rest of house is empty on top. We really feel the heat at night.... Especially in kitchen and service balcony. Like an oven on days that don't rain.

Luckily rooms have roof built over too, but the kitchen being the exposed part is really hot
